Local tips

  • Visit early in the day for the best chance to see elephants actively roaming and playing.
  • Bring binoculars for a closer view of the elephants without disturbing them.
  • Pack a picnic to enjoy in designated areas, surrounded by the beauty of nature.
  • Wear comfortable shoes as the park has several walking paths for exploration.
  • Respect the wildlife and maintain a safe distance from the elephants at all times.

Getting There

  • Car

    If you're driving, head towards the central area of Minneriya National Park. Use a GPS device or a maps application to navigate to the coordinates 8.022685, 80.8504201. Follow the park roads, and look for signposts indicating the direction to Rambawilla Elephant Watching. The journey should take about 20-30 minutes depending on traffic and wildlife sightings along the way. Be mindful of speed limits and wildlife on the roads.

  • Public Transportation

    If you're using public transportation, take a local bus from Habarana or Polonnaruwa to Minneriya. Once you reach Minneriya, you can hire a tuk-tuk or a taxi to take you to Rambawilla Elephant Watching. Make sure to negotiate the fare in advance; it should cost around 500-1000 LKR. The ride will take approximately 15-20 minutes.

  • Walking

    If you're already within the vicinity of Rambawilla, you can walk. From the nearest park entrance, follow the dirt trails leading to Rambawilla, making sure to stay on marked paths for safety. This walk can take anywhere from 30-45 minutes, depending on your pace. Keep an eye out for local wildlife and carry enough water.

Discover more about Rambawilla Elephant Watching

Rambawilla Elephant Watching is a remarkable destination for tourists seeking to experience the grandeur of elephants in their natural habitat. This park is an idyllic escape into the heart of nature, allowing visitors to observe these magnificent creatures as they roam freely. The park is designed to provide a safe and respectful environment for both the elephants and the guests, making it a top choice for animal lovers. Visitors can witness the gentle giants interacting with each other, bathing in the nearby streams, and enjoying the lush greenery that surrounds them. The sight of elephants in their natural habitat is truly captivating, offering a unique perspective on wildlife conservation and the importance of protecting these incredible animals. The park is open daily from 9 AM to 6 PM, ensuring ample opportunity to experience the beauty of the elephants throughout the day.
